离线存储指的是:在用户没有与因特网连接时,可以正常访问站点或应用,在用户与因特网连接时,更新用户机器上的缓存文件。通过这个文件上的解析清单离线存储资源,这些资源就会像cookie一样被存储了下来。之后当网络在处于离线状态下时,浏览器会通过被离线存储的数据进行页面展示在线的情况下,浏览器发现 html 头部有 manifest 属性,它会请求 manifest 文件,如果是第一次访问页面 ,那么浏
转载
2023-08-07 11:39:23
100阅读
TML5提供了一种离线应用缓存机制,使得网页应用可以离线使用,这种机制在移动端浏览器上支持度非常广,所有版本的android和ios浏览器都能很好的支持。我们可以放心的使用该特性来加速移动端页面的访问速度。开启离线缓存的步骤也非常简单:(1) 准备缓存清单文件(menifest text/cache-manifest),用于描述页面需要缓存的资源列表(2) 在需要离线使用的页面中添加menifes
转载
2023-06-14 22:06:53
207阅读
离线缓存是HTML5提供的新功能.利用HTML5提供的离线缓存功能可以将站点的一些常用的文件缓存到本地,在没有网络的情况下依旧可以访问缓存的页面。 可以被缓存的文件类型有很多,包括但不限于html,css,js,静态图片资源等。事实上,离线缓存不仅仅在没有网络的情况下会被使用,当有网络的情况下,本地缓存过的文件依旧会被优先使用。有网络的情况下,浏览器会返回200,离线缓存有很多好处。第一 
转载
2023-06-27 23:07:47
183阅读
在用户没有与因特网连接时,可以正常访问站点或应用,在用户与因特网连接时,更新用户机器上的缓存文件。原理:HTML5的离线存储是基于一个新建的.appcache文件的缓存机制(不是存储技术),通过这个文件上的解析清单离线存储资源,这些资源就会像cookie一样被存储了下来。之后当网络在处于离线状态下时,浏览器会通过被离线存储的数据进行页面展示。如何使用:1、页面头部像下面一样加入一个manifest
转载
2023-11-16 19:03:38
73阅读
10. HTML5 的离线储存怎么使用, 它的工作原理是什么?定义离线存储是指在用户没有与因特网连接时, 可以正常访问站点或应用, 在用户与因特网连接时, 更新用户机器上的缓存文件。原理HTML5 的离线存储是基于一个新建的 .appcache 文件的缓存机制(不是存储技术), 通过这个文件上的解析清单离线存储资源, 这些资源就会像 cookie 一样被存储了下来。之后当网络在处于离线状态下时,
转载
2023-05-26 16:59:26
123阅读
本篇文章给大家带来的内容是关于HTML5缓存机制是什么?怎么更新缓存,有一定的参考价值,有需要的朋友可以参考一下,希望对你有所帮助。【推荐阅读:Html5教程】背景离线缓存是HTML5提供的新功能。利用HTML5提供的离线缓存功能可以将站点的一些常用的文件缓存到本地,在没有网络的情况下依旧可以访问缓存的页面。可以被缓存的文件类型有很多,包括但不限于html,css,js,静态图片资源等。事实上,离
转载
2024-01-31 20:13:14
33阅读
html5 离线缓存 测试案例链接:html5通过application cache API提供离线存储功能,前提是需要访问的web页面至少被在线访问过一次一、离线本地存储和传统的浏览器缓存区别浏览器缓存主要包含两类:缓存协商:Last-modified,Etag浏览器向服务器询问页面是否被修改过,如果没有修改就返回304,浏览器直接浏览本地缓存文件,否则服务器返回新内容彻底缓存:cache-
转载
2023-09-25 09:18:26
45阅读
只要在头部加一个manifest属性<html manifest = "cache.manifest">然后cache.manifest文件的书写方式如下:CACHE MANIFEST#v0.11CACHE:js/app.jscss/style.cssNETWORK:resourse/logo.pngFALLBACK:/ /offline.html离线存储的manifest一般由三个部
转载
2023-06-27 23:04:18
93阅读
干什么用的? 离线缓存为的是第一次请求后,根据manifest文件进行本地缓存,并且在下一次请求后进行展示(若有缓存的话,无需再次进行请求而是直接调用缓存),最根本的感觉是它使得WEB从online可以延伸到了offline领域。应用场景h5游戏及一些页面内容不经常会变动,相对较为固定的内容。一、基本概念离线缓存是HTML5新引入的技术,能够让你的Web应用程序指定哪些文件可以缓存在本地
转载
2023-08-15 10:14:09
80阅读
今天说说HTML5的新特性之一:离线应用缓存。 离线应用,就是在没有网络的情况下访问Web应用程序时,实际上是访问已下载的离线文件资源,并使得Web应用程序正常运行。特性开发者需要注意三个特性:1. 离线资源缓存在开发离线应用时,必须使用一种方案来说明哪些文件资源需要在离线状态下工作。当设备处于在线状态下,被指定缓存的资源文件便会缓存到本地。此后,如果用户在离线状态下再次访问该Web应用程序,浏
转载
2023-09-03 11:50:14
230阅读
HTML5 IndexedDB:轻量级NoSQL数据库IndexedDB是HTML5-WebStorage的重要一环,是一种轻量级NoSQL数据库。w3c为IndexedDB定义了很多接口,其中Database对象被定义为IDBDataBase。浏览器对象中,实现了IDBFactory的只有indexedDB这个实例。五步创建HTML5离线Web应用在HTML5提供的所有炫酷功能里,创建离线缓存网
转载
2023-07-24 18:00:17
86阅读
关于HTML5离线存储原理及实现,笔者找到一篇介绍离线缓存的,感觉比之前看到的解释的更透彻,新的知识点记录如下: 大家都知道Web App是通过浏览器来访问的,所以离线状态下是无法使用app的。其中web app中的一些资源并不经常改变,不需要每次都向服务器发送请求。这时应运而生的离线缓存就显得尤为突出。通过把需要离线缓存储的文件列在一个manifest配置文件中。这样在离线情况下也可以使用app
转载
2023-06-23 22:33:14
55阅读
用到离线存储的原因:越来越多的APP使用H5开发,通过浏览器进行访问,浏览器访问就需要互联网请求,在手机断网的情况下,就无法使用APP,而且很多资源是不需要随时更改的,综合这些原因,h5提供了一个新特性–离线存储。 用法:在页面头部加入manifest<!DOCTYPE HTML>
<html manifest = "cache.manifest">
...
</ht
转载
2023-08-15 10:14:01
95阅读
Html5 引入了应用程序缓存,这意味着web应用可以进行缓存,并且可以在没有网络连接的时候进行访问。1.1 什么是Cache Manifest首先manifest是一个后缀名为minifest或者appcache,的文件,在文件中定义那些需要缓存的文件,支持manifest的浏览器,会将按照manifest文件的规则,像文件保存在本地,从而在没有网络链接的情况下,也能访问页面。当我们第一次正确配
转载
2023-09-27 19:26:33
70阅读
实例 - 完整的 Manifest 文件 1,什么是应用程序缓存(Application Cache) HTML5 引入了应用程序缓存,这意味着 web 应用可进行缓存,并可在没有因特网连接时进行访问。 离线缓存: 离线缓存可以将站点的一些文件缓存到本地,它是浏览器自己的一种机制, 将需要的文件缓存下来,以便后期即使没有连接网络,被缓存的页面也可以展示
转载
2023-07-21 14:07:34
47阅读
离线存储可以将站点的一些文件存储在本地,它是浏览器自己的一种机制,将需要的文件缓存下来在没有网络的时候可以访问到缓存的对应的站点页面,包括html,js,css,img等等文件在有网络的时候,浏览器也会优先使用已离线存储的文件,返回一个200(from cache)头。这跟HTTP的缓存使用策略是不同的。资源的缓存可以带来更好的用户体验,当用户使用自己的流量上网时,本地缓存不仅可以提高用户访问速度
转载
2023-10-18 16:57:26
97阅读
一、离线缓存的起因。5之前的网页,都是无连接,必须联网才能访问,这其实也是web的特色,这其实对于PC是时代问题并不大,但到了移动互联网时代,设备终端位置不再固定,依赖无线信号,网络的可靠性变得降低,比如坐在火车上,过了一个隧道(15分钟),便无法访问网站,十分不便。而离线web应用允许我们在脱机时与网站进行交互。二、什么是离线Web应程序?为什么要开发离线的Web应用程序?离线web应用程序是指
转载
2024-03-03 10:32:13
67阅读
详细介绍HTML5的离线储存(工作原理+使用场景+真实使用步骤)前言:一、工作原理:二、使用场景:三、使用步骤1. 创建并配置缓存清单2. 将缓存清单与HTML文件相关联3. 使用JavaScript调用应用程序缓存对象4. 测试离线缓存四、注意事项 前言:HTML5提供了一种称为离线储存(offline storage)的功能,它允许Web应用程序在浏览器离线时继续访问相关资源,以提高Web应
转载
2023-08-09 23:26:14
145阅读
html5几种在客户端存储数据的实例详解LocalStorage LocalStorage用于持久化的本地存储,存储资料在客户端(client)的浏览器上,除非主动删除数据,否则数 据是永远不会过期的。LocalStorage使用键值对的方式进行存储,存储的方式只能是字符串。存储内容可以有图片、json、样式、脚html5中的离线存储的实现原理是怎样的这个可以叫做浏览器存储,也就是说他在。谷歌内核
转载
2023-08-19 00:41:19
117阅读
本文主要内容归纳如下:一、离线存储的作用;二、如何实现离线存储;三、applicationCache对象,及属性、事件、接口四、访问缓存应用,相应触发事件,及其对应状态;五、如何更新离线缓存六、demo演示:update后是否调用swapCache的区别;七、写在后面 一、离线存储的作用1、用户可离线访问你的应用,这对于无法随时保持联网状态的移动终端用户来说尤其重要2、用户访问本地的缓存
转载
2024-05-17 08:11:31
63阅读